The Writer as Someone to Be

 

      Writer is a glamorous job.

      You are your own person.  You don’t punch a time clock.

      You don’t do team-building exercises with your co-workers.  You don’t male-bond.  You aren’t a slave to fashion.  You don’t keep up with the Joneses.

      You live the life of the mind, unbought and unbossed.

      You march to your own drummer.

      You go your own way.

      You don’t care if anybody follows you or not.  That’s not the point.  The point is being able to do it, to be the master of your own fate.

      You decide what you are going to do and when you are going to do it.  If you need something, you figure out how to get it.  If you don’t need it, you do without.

      You are pragmatic.  Practical.

      What looks like lunacy is really simple common sense.
